Understanding Transformer Oil BDV Test Kits Importance and Usage


Transformer oils play a crucial role in the operation and longevity of electrical transformers. These oils serve multiple purposes including insulation, cooling, and preventing corrosion. Over time, however, transformer oils can degrade due to exposure to heat, moisture, and various contaminants, which may compromise their effectiveness. To ensure the reliability and safety of transformers, it is essential to monitor the quality of the transformer oil, which is where the Breakdown Voltage (BDV) test kits come into play.


What is BDV Testing?


Breakdown Voltage testing is a standard method used to evaluate the dielectric strength of transformer oil. Dielectric strength refers to the maximum voltage that an insulating material can withstand without failure. For transformer oil, a high dielectric strength indicates good insulation properties, while a low BDV may suggest contamination or degradation of the oil, leading to potential failure of the transformer. Regular BDV testing is therefore vital in preventative maintenance strategies.


Significance of Transformer Oil BDV Test Kits


1. Prevention of Failures By regularly monitoring the BDV of transformer oil, technicians can identify potential issues before they lead to transformer failures. High BDV indicates that the oil is still functioning effectively, while a declining BDV can signal the need for oil purification or replacement.


2. Enhancing Transformer Lifespan Keeping the transformer oil in optimal condition not only ensures that the transformer operates efficiently but also extends its operational lifespan. This translates to reduced maintenance costs and increased reliability.


3. Safety Compliance Many industries are subject to stringent safety regulations regarding electrical equipment. Regular BDV testing ensures compliance with these regulations and helps in maintaining safety standards in the workplace.


Components of a BDV Test Kit


A typical transformer oil BDV test kit includes several key components


- Test Cell The test cell is the most critical part of the BDV test kit where the oil sample is placed. It usually consists of two electrodes that are submerged in the oil. The distance between the electrodes can be adjusted based on the test requirements.


- Power Supply The test kit is equipped with a high-voltage power supply that gradually increases voltage until breakdown occurs. The power supply must be capable of providing a controlled voltage to ensure accurate readings.

- Measurement Device This device records the voltage level at which the oil breaks down, thus determining the BDV. It is essential that the measurement device is accurate and reliable.


- User Manual and Safety Equipment Since the testing process involves high voltages, safety gear such as gloves and goggles is typically included in the kit, along with a user manual to guide operators through the testing process.


How to Perform a BDV Test


Performing a BDV test involves several steps


1. Sample Collection Collect a sufficient oil sample from the transformer, ensuring it is free from any external contamination.


2. Preparation Prepare the test cell by cleaning it and installing the electrodes at the correct distance.


3. Filling the Cell Pour the oil sample into the test cell, ensuring that it covers the electrodes completely.


4. Testing Connect the power supply and gradually increase the voltage while monitoring the reading. The test continues until the oil breaks down, at which point the voltage is recorded.


5. Analysis Analyze the BDV reading. Generally, a BDV above 30 kV is considered acceptable for new oils, while a lower BDV indicates the need for further investigation or action.
